Definition
(This chocolate pudding) is low in saturated fat: (This chocolate pudding) has very little animal fat, contains a small amount of saturated fat
(This cream bun) is high in saturated fat: (This cream bun) has a lot of saturated fat, contains a high amount of animal fat
Examples
- "For example, the Mediterranean diet, which includes small portions of high-quality foods low in saturated fat, has proven to be much more healthy than the American diet, for example."
- "The American diet often consists of large portions of food high in saturated fat."
